Reclaiming urban rivers

Historical background

  • Nearly all major cities were built on a river.
  • Rivers were traditionally used by city dwellers for transport, fishing and recreation.
  • Industrial development and rising populations later led to:

- more sewage from houses being discharged into the river

- pollution from 31 ______________ on the river bank.

  • In 1957, the River Thames in London was declared biologically 32 ______________.

Recent improvements

  • Seals and even a 33 ______________ have been seen in the River Thames.
  • Riverside warehouses are converted to restaurants and 34 ______________.
  • In Los Angeles, there are plans to:

- build a riverside 35 ______________.

- display 36 ______________ projects.

  • In Paris, 37 ______________ are created on the sides of the river every summer.

Transport possibilities

  • Over 2 billion passengers already travel by 38 ______________.
  • Changes in shopping habits mean the number of deliveries that are made is increasing.
  • Instead of road transport, goods could be transported by large freight barges and electric 39 ______________, or in the future, by 40 ______________.
